Analysis of strengths

One of the most praised features of this holiday home is its location. Situated in close proximity to the Maasplassen, the largest contiguous water sports area in the Netherlands, it offers an excellent base for sailing, surfing, swimming, and fishing enthusiasts. The surrounding area is also perfect for hiking and cycling through the Central Limburg landscape. This connection with nature offers a peace and tranquility rarely found in an urban hotel. Critical considerations and drawbacks

Despite the advantages, there are important considerations. Booking through a large platform like NOVASOL, which manages thousands of holiday apartments and villas , leads to a standardized, yet sometimes impersonal, experience. This is in stark contrast to the personal attention one can expect at a small posada or a family-run hostel .

A common criticism of rental platforms is the additional costs. The advertised rental price rarely reflects the final price. Bed linens, final cleaning, tourist tax, and sometimes even an advance payment for energy are charged separately. While this is standard practice in the holiday apartment industry, it can come as an unpleasant surprise to inexperienced renters. It's crucial to carefully read the rental terms and conditions to understand the total cost.

Variability in quality and maintenance

Because the holiday homes managed by NOVASOL are privately owned, the state of maintenance and quality of the interiors can vary. While one home may be modern and perfectly maintained, another may show signs of wear and tear or outdated furnishings. This is an inherent risk when booking a department or house through an intermediary, as opposed to a resort or hotel chain with standardized quality standards. Therefore, it is strongly recommended to search for recent reviews of specific property HLI073 and not rely solely on NOVASOL's overall star rating. Complaints about cleaning are unfortunately common in the sector and can significantly impact a stay.
